Output 4cc0327b5962d624a9fb393c8f8b1ea29436daf25f94d7906772dc3a25947787:5

value
6148894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cc2dec71531a96acba226693670e2d9d7c88ad9 OP_EQUAL
address
34K6Hjcu5KsPgvR9JgoSstMpQsP8JGQJFC
transaction
4cc0327b5962d624a9fb393c8f8b1ea29436daf25f94d7906772dc3a25947787
confirmations
285346
spent
true